Summary

News and Updates: • Microsoft Copilot Discord Backlash: Microsoft’s attempt to ban the term ”Microslop” on its Copilot Discord server backfired, leading to massive spamming and the eventual temporary closure of the community. • Data Center Grid Risks: Sudden disconnections of Virginia data centers from the power grid have sparked reliability concerns, as simultaneous shifts to backup power can destabilize regional energy supplies. • Surge in Energy Demand: Projections indicate data centers could consume 17% of U.S. electricity by 2030, placing immense pressure on utilities to balance massive, fluctuating industrial power loads. • Burger King’s AI Coaching: Burger King is piloting ”Patty,” an AI headset assistant that monitors employee friendliness by tracking phrases like ”please” and ”thank you” during customer interactions. • Claude Tops App Store: Anthropic’s Claude overtook ChatGPT as the #1 free U.S. app following public disputes over AI safeguards and controversial Pentagon contracts involving OpenAI’s military partnerships.
